What's new at Joe's House?
- New hospitals in Saginaw, MI:
- Covenant
HealthCare (Cancer Care & Infusion Therapy)
- St. Mary's of Michigan (Seton Cancer Center)
- Two
new hospitality houses in Saginaw; McNally House and Emerson House.
Both offer a "home away from home" for patients traveling to Saignaw for
treatment and offer rooms in either house for $20 per night.
- New Orleans additions- Tulane Medical Center on Tulane Ave and Tulane Lakeside Hospital.
- Updated
rates from Drury Hotels; including rates of $89.99 at both the Houston
and San Antonio Medical Center and new set rates at the Phoenix Airport,
both Birmingham locations, Columbus, OH and New Orleans.

We get hundreds of calls a month and scores of emails each week. Here
are just a few of the stories from patients, family members and social
workers. Sharon was looking for financial assistance, lodging and air
transportation. While Joe's House does not offer financial help we
steered her in the right direction while helping with lodging and
sending her to National Patient Travel Helpline for air travel. Jim was
very grateful for lodging information in Columbia, MO as was Stacey for
information for a patient traveling to Maine.
